For generations, small and mid-sized farms reliably fed people and cared for the environment and animals. But factory farms upended this relationship. Today, legal and policy failures have allowed a handful of giant corporations — like Smithfield, JBS and Tyson — to have a stranglehold on our food system.
Far from the idyllic images of healthy animals on family farms, the vast majority of farmed animals are raised on factory farms designed to confine large numbers of animals in intensive, unsanitary and cruel conditions — treating them as commodities, not as living beings. The conditions these animals live in foster the spread of disease, and routinely subject them to brutality and violence.
